Here’s What Baba Ramdev’s Day Looks Like

We have all seen Baba Ramdev on TV talking about the importance of yoga in one’s life and living a healthy life. But what does his day look like? Well, Kamiya Jani recently got to talk and even live a day like him. His day starts super early at 3 in the morning. After that, he meditates for almost an hour and then jogs for almost 5 km around the campus!

Then, he goes live on TV at 5 AM and even does a Facebook live to connect with more people. His yoga sessions, both on TV and social media, go on till 10 AM. Post this, he starts his work and goes around the campus and looks into everything that requires his attention. According to him, “10 AM se 10 PM tak mera karam yog chalta rehta hai.”

What He Eats Throughout The Day

Now, you’d expect someone who gets up at 3 AM to at least eat a few times a day. However, Baba Ramdev eats only once a day! He even explained the reason behind it with a Sanskrit shloka. He explains that a person who eats once a day stays healthy or “nirogya”. A person who exercises, works out a lot or works as a farmer, can take up two meals a day, as they tend to burn it off. As for people who eat three meals a day, they tend to stay unhealthy or “sada rogi”. Lastly, those who take four meals a day would end up dead sooner rather than later!
